Three More Athletes Commit to College Athletics

     Three Saints athletes signed this afternoon to continue their athletic careers in college. Gracie Caplice will play tennis at Washington & Lee, Reagan Hardy will play softball at Bluefield and Parker Longood will run track at Washington & Lee.

     They join eight classmates who signed in the fall:
  • Hannah Ballowe, Virginia Tech Cross Country/Track & Field
  • Ashley Boardman, Colby College Soccer
  • Julia Galbraith, US Naval Academy Cross Country/Track & Field
  • Doxey Loupassi, Dickinson College Squash (Division I for squash)
  • Lilli Marcia, VCU Soccer
  • Maya McDonough, Middlebury College Squash (Division I for squash)
  • Caroline Reinhart, Stanford Field Hockey
  • Kalli Wagnon, University of California-Davis Field Hockey
     Fifteen percent of the Class of 2019 will compete in college athletics.
